The upcoming Etrian Odyssey Origins Collection will feature a number of characters from Atlus' Shin Megami Tensei and Persona franchises as DLC portraits for the playable characters. Last week, Nintendo held a presentation that showed off various games that will be coming to the Switch in the first half of 2023. The February 2023 Nintendo Direct featured a number of remasters and remakes for some classic games, which included a number of DS games being ported to the system. One of these was the Etrian Odyssey Origins Collection, an HD remaster of the series' DS trilogy.While Atlus is more well-known for the Shin Megami Tensei and Persona franchises, it is also the developer of the Etrian Odyssey games. These are dungeon-crawling JRPGs that utilized the dual screens of the Nintendo DS and 3DS systems. This collection will feature the first three Etrian Odyssey games, where players form a part of adventurers of various classes. Atlus revealed that this collection will feature DLC which stars characters from its various franchises as DLC. In a tweet from Atlus and on its official website, new character portraits were revealed, which are available as both pre-order and post-launch DLC. The DLC can be purchased for $3 USD per pack. These are all characters from both the Shin Megami Tensei and Persona series. More specifically, these are portraits of the Demi-Fiend from Shin Megami Tensei 3, Nahobino from Shin Megami Tensei 5, Aigis from Persona 3, Teddie from Persona 4, Joker from Persona 5, and Ringo from Soul Hackers 2.
These character portrait DLCs are essentially costumes for any class that the player wishes to create. For example, Joker can be classified as the Protector class in Etrian Odyssey 1 with this DLC applied. Atlus notes that these costumes can only be accessed in certain games in this remastered trilogy. Joker and Ringo are only available in Etrian Odyssey HD, Demi-Fiend and Teddie are only accessible in Etrian Odyssey 2 HD, with Nahobino and Aigis available in Etrian Odyssey 3 HD.
The DLC should be a fun addition for those who love Atlus' library of games, with many commenting on the dissonance of having characters like Demi-Fiend and Teddie in the same game compressed to Etrian Odyssey's art style. While this collection compiles these three games, it will also be the test bed for future Etrian Odyssey titles. The developers asked for feedback about the trilogy, which can be utilized to help develop games following the trilogy's release.
Etrian Odyssey Origins Collection will be released on June 1st, 2023 for the Nintendo Switch and PC.
